Party Popcorn & Nuts
- 8 cups popped popcorn
- 1 (11.5-ounce) can (2 cups) salted mixed nuts or peanuts
- 1/3 cup Land O Lakes Butter
- 1/3 cup maple-flavored syrup or light corn syrup
- 1/4 cup firmly packed brown sugar
- 1 teaspoon seasoned salt
- 1 cup candy corn
- Heat oven to 250F.
- Line 15x10x1-inch baking pan with aluminum foil; spray foil with no-stick cooking spray.
- Set aside.
- Combine popcorn and nuts in bowl; set aside.
- Combine butter, syrup and brown sugar in 1-quart saucepan.
- Cook over medium heat, stirring constantly, 4-6 minutes or until mixture comes to a full boil.
- Continue cooking 1 minute.
- Pour butter mixture over popcorn mixture; stir well to coat.
- Spoon into prepared pan.
- Bake 1 hour, stirring every 15 minutes.
- Remove from oven; sprinkle with seasoned salt.
- Cool completely in pan.
- Break up pieces.
- Place into large serving bowl; sprinkle with candy corn.
- Store in food container with tight-fitting lid.
